Output 76a99ccdfa1d908b63bc5fd6321c5a52bb8966bd6a3a1eb9309751bb2e813b76:0

value
667444872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fe65faa4d7050feb14a1af736fb96dfb4fe4b77 OP_EQUAL
address
MNUdeaMsHeLPvbJ9ghyyfGtwiyUKRUN68m
transaction
76a99ccdfa1d908b63bc5fd6321c5a52bb8966bd6a3a1eb9309751bb2e813b76
spent
true